BSA Calls for US Leadership in AI Following Trump Executive Order
WASHINGTON – Business Software Alliance Senior Vice President of Global Policy Aaron Cooper issued the following statement after the signing of President Donald Trump’s Executive Order on “Removing Barriers to American Leadership in Artificial Intelligence.”
“We applaud the Trump Administration’s Executive Order on leadership in artificial intelligence (AI). Most importantly, the Order sets improving lives, the economy, and security, as the overarching objective of American AI policy.
The United States has long been a beacon of economic leadership led by innovation. We welcome President Trump’s commitment to reinvigorating US leadership on the direction of AI policy, as well. We look forward to working with the administration as it develops its Action Plan called for in the Executive Order.
We stand ready to help achieve the goal of advancing AI innovation, and BSA has already contributed to this important priority, including in its Policy Solutions for Building Responsible AI that encompasses easily implementable solutions to address the most significant issues to advance the adoption of responsible AI across the economy.
Today, there are a myriad of regulations and proposals from different agencies and across all 50 states. The US will better succeed if there are clear, consistent rules and direction at the national level that achieve the policy objective of this order.”
